Hey!! I'm doing my yr 10 mocks right after easter and this is how I've planned it, so basically what i did was i drew a 3 timetables, 1 for each week i have to revise and i wrote down the timings on one side and day of the week on the top. then i wrote out all the topics of content i need to revise on little post it notes and i put them in the different boxes on the timetable. I've allocated the first 2 weeks as content weeks where ill revise all the content i need and then the 3rd week is for past papers and questions. We also get to revise during the exam week and i haven't made a plan for that yet but i think I'll just print off some extra past papers that i can do during that time.
